Inexpensive analog equipment for processing gas chromatography mass spectrometry data
Simple analog circuitry and an inexpensive tape recorder enable spectral analysis and mass chromatogram reconstruction. This cost-effective method also facilitates peak matching and selective ion detection in sector instruments.

Background:
- Traditional mass spectrometry data acquisition can be complex and expensive.
- There is a need for accessible methods for spectral analysis and data processing.
Purpose of the Study:
- To present a cost-effective analog system for mass spectrometry data analysis.
- To demonstrate the utility of analog circuitry and tape recorders for spectral data storage and retrieval.
Main Methods:
- Utilized simple analog circuitry and an analog frequency modulated tape recorder for data storage.
- Employed an oscilloscope for examining repetitively scanned spectra.
- Developed methods for reconstructing mass chromatograms from stored analog data.
Main Results:
- Successfully reconstructed mass chromatograms from analog tape recordings.
- Demonstrated the capability of the system for peak matching.
- Showcased selective ion detection across the full mass range of a sector instrument.
Conclusions:
- Simple analog systems offer a viable and economical approach to mass spectrometry data analysis.
- Inexpensive analog tape recorders can serve as effective data storage solutions for spectral data.
- The described methods provide accessible tools for researchers with limited resources.
